The U.S. import of statuettes and ornamental articles of porcelain or china is forecasted to decline significantly from 2024 to 2028. In 2023, this import category was valued at approximately $38 million. Forecasted figures reveal a downward trend, with a sharp drop each year: 30.726 in 2024, 23.431 in 2025, 16.281 in 2026, 9.2739 in 2027, and 2.4071 in 2028, all values in million USD. The compound annual growth rate (CAGR) over the forecasted period projects a considerable negative average variation per year.
